GO TERM SUMMARY

Name: nitric oxide biosynthetic process
Acc: GO:0006809
Aspect: Biological Process
Desc: The chemical reactions and pathways resulting in the formation of nitric oxide, nitrogen monoxide (NO), a colorless gas only slightly soluble in water.
Synonyms:
  • nitric oxide biosynthesis
  • nitric oxide synthesis
  • nitric oxide formation
  • nitric oxide anabolism
